摘要
In this work, we present the application of specially constructed adaptive basis functions to generate a diagonal matrix in the method-of-moments solution procedure for the calculation of a scattered electromagnetic field from arbitrarily shaped two-dimensional cylinders excited by a transverse electric incident electromagnetic wave. Several numerical examples are also presented to validate the new method. (C) 2001 John Wiley & Sons, Inc.
